技术文摘
Python:大数据全栈式开发语言
Python:大数据全栈式开发语言
在当今数字化时代,数据呈爆炸式增长,大数据领域的发展日新月异。而Python,作为一种强大的编程语言,已然成为大数据全栈式开发的首选语言。
Python具有简洁易懂的语法。与其他编程语言相比,Python的代码更加简洁明了,这使得开发者能够更快速地编写和理解代码。例如,在处理数据时,只需几行代码就能实现复杂的数据操作,大大提高了开发效率。这种简洁性不仅降低了开发成本,还吸引了众多初学者投身于大数据开发领域。
强大的数据分析库是Python在大数据领域的一大优势。NumPy、Pandas和Matplotlib等库为数据处理、分析和可视化提供了丰富的功能。NumPy提供了高效的多维数组对象和计算工具,Pandas则擅长数据的清洗、整理和分析,Matplotlib能够创建各种精美的可视化图表。这些库的结合使用,让开发者能够轻松地从海量数据中提取有价值的信息,并以直观的方式呈现出来。
在数据挖掘和机器学习方面,Python同样表现出色。Scikit-learn、TensorFlow等流行的机器学习库为开发者提供了丰富的算法和模型。无论是分类、聚类还是预测分析,Python都能提供高效的解决方案。而且,Python的代码可以很方便地在不同平台上运行,这为大数据开发的跨平台应用提供了便利。
Python还具有良好的可扩展性和兼容性。它可以与其他编程语言和工具进行无缝集成,例如与数据库、云计算平台等的结合,进一步拓展了其在大数据领域的应用范围。
对于全栈式开发来说,Python不仅能处理后端的数据处理和分析,还能通过各种Web框架如Django、Flask等开发前端界面。这使得开发者能够独立完成从数据获取、处理到展示的整个流程。
Python凭借其简洁的语法、强大的数据分析库、出色的机器学习能力以及良好的可扩展性和兼容性,成为了大数据全栈式开发的理想语言,在大数据领域发挥着越来越重要的作用。
- 基于 pandas 的数据移动计算应用
- 70 行代码打造桌面自动翻译利器!
- React 部分卓越安全实践
- 你了解 Type="Module" ,那 Type="Importmap" 呢?
- Springboot 项目中配置多个 Kafka 消费者的方法探讨
- 正确配置入口文件的方法
- RabbitMQ 怎样实现消息路由
- 编写 JavaScript 代码的四大关键原则
- 菜鸟借助 Python 完成网站自动签到,令人称赞
- Python 3.10 中“match...case”的使用
- Python 中可观测性的七大关键部分
- C 开发中三种中段错误调试方法
- Nuclei 进阶:Workflows、Matchers 与 Extractors 的深度解读
- 六个令人意外的 JavaScript 问题
- 微软新工具准确率 80% 引程序员吐槽